Steviolbioside

Description:
Steviolbioside is a natural glycoside derived from the stevia plant, specifically from the leaves of Stevia rebaudiana. It is known for its intense sweetness, which is attributed to its steviol backbone. This compound is characterized by its high solubility in water and stability under various pH conditions, making it suitable for use as a sweetener in food and beverages. Steviolbioside is non-caloric, which contributes to its popularity as a sugar substitute, particularly among those seeking to reduce caloric intake or manage blood sugar levels. Additionally, it has been studied for its potential health benefits, including antioxidant properties. The compound is generally recognized as safe (GRAS) by regulatory agencies, although its sweetness potency can vary depending on the specific formulation and concentration. Its use is expanding in the food industry, particularly in products aimed at health-conscious consumers. Overall, steviolbioside represents a significant advancement in the development of natural sweeteners.

    Steviolbioside is a natural sweetener, it presents notable inhibition on human hepatocarcinoma cell Hep3B, human breast cancer cell MDA-MB-231 and human pancreatic cancer cell BxPC-3, thus, steviolbioside could be a potential remedy for human breast cancer. Steviolbioside also exhibits moderate antituberculosis activity against M. tuberculosis strain H37RV in vitro.

    <p>Steviolbioside is a high-intensity sweetening compound, classified as a steviol glycoside. It is derived from the plant Stevia rebaudiana, a member of the Asteraceae family, which is native to South America. The mode of action of Steviolbioside involves interacting with sweet taste receptors on the human tongue, specifically the TAS1R2 and TAS1R3 receptor heterodimer, mimicking the sweetness perceived from traditional sugars but without eliciting a caloric response.</p>
